The Los Angeles Dodgers have the oldest lineup in Major League Baseball in 2026. The average age of their offensive players is 30.7.
The Dodgers also had an average age of 30.7 across all their batters in 2025, making them the oldest lineup in the majors. They eventually won the World Series for a second straight season.
Oldest MLB Lineups 2026
| Team | Average Age |
|---|---|
| Dodgers | 30.7 |
| Phillies | 30.1 |
| Braves | 29.6 |
| Padres | 29.6 |
| Yankees | 29.4 |
| Rangers | 29.4 |
| Astros | 29 |
| Cubs | 28.9 |
| Blue Jays | 28.9 |
| Twins | 28.7 |
Which MLB Team has the Youngest Lineup in 2026?
The Washington Nationals have an average age of 24.9 for their offensive players, giving them the youngest lineup in MLB this season.
